## Documentation Page: Diagnostics Module Settings
|
||||
|
||||
### 1. Purpose
|
||||
This module provides application-level settings infrastructure for the *Diagnostics* submodule within the TestSetups module of the DataPRO system. It exposes a strongly-typed settings class (`Diagnostics.Properties.Settings`) derived from `ApplicationSettingsBase`, enabling centralized, persisted configuration access for diagnostic-related runtime parameters. The module itself contains no executable logic beyond the auto-generated settings infrastructure—it serves as a configuration contract point for the diagnostics module, likely consumed by other components in the diagnostics pipeline (e.g., test setup validation, diagnostic reporting, or hardware interaction modules).
